How to Add an AI Chatbot to Your Website in 2026 (Step-by-Step)
Adding an AI chatbot to your website used to require developers, expensive software, and weeks of configuration. In 2026, you can do it in under 5 minutes with zero coding experience. This guide walks you through the entire process.
Why Add an AI Chatbot to Your Website?
Before we get into the how, let's talk about the why. If you're running a business website in 2026, you're almost certainly losing leads right now. Here's the reality:
- 79% of visitors leave a website without taking any action. Many of them had questions but couldn't find answers fast enough.
- Live chat increases conversions by 20%, but only if someone is actually there to respond. Most small businesses can't staff a chat desk 24/7.
- The average response time for email inquiries is 12 hours. By then, your prospect has already contacted a competitor.
An AI chatbot solves all three problems. It's available 24/7, responds instantly, and captures lead information during the conversation. It's like having a tireless sales assistant that never sleeps, never takes breaks, and never forgets to follow up.
Step 1: Choose a Chatbot Platform
The first step is picking the right tool. There are dozens of options, but for most small businesses, you want something that's:
- Easy to set up — no coding required
- Actually AI-powered — not just a decision tree that says "I don't understand" to every other question
- Affordable — ideally with a free plan to start
- Focused on lead capture — collecting names, emails, and phone numbers
For this tutorial, we'll use ChatLeadAI as our example because it checks all four boxes and has the fastest setup process we've tested. But the general principles apply to most modern chatbot platforms.
Pro tip: Don't overthink the platform choice. Pick one with a free plan, test it for a week, and see if it works for your visitors. You can always switch later.
Step 2: Train the AI on Your Business
This is where modern AI chatbots are fundamentally different from the old rule-based bots. Instead of manually writing every possible question and answer, you simply give the AI your content and it learns your business.
With ChatLeadAI, you have two options:
- Paste your website URL — the AI crawls your pages and extracts information about your products, services, pricing, FAQs, and more.
- Upload documents — feed it PDFs, Word docs, or plain text files with information you want the bot to know.
The training process takes about 30 seconds. Once complete, your chatbot can answer questions about your business accurately and naturally. No prompt engineering required.
What kind of content should you include?
- Your main website pages (home, about, services, pricing)
- Frequently asked questions
- Product or service descriptions
- Pricing and packages
- Contact information and business hours
- Any policies (returns, cancellations, warranties)
Step 3: Customize the Look and Feel
Nobody wants a chatbot that looks like it was slapped on as an afterthought. Modern platforms let you customize the widget to match your brand. Here's what you should configure:
- Brand colors — match your primary brand color so the chat widget looks native to your site
- Bot name and avatar — give it a name that fits your brand (e.g., "Sarah" for a friendly tone, "Support" for a professional tone)
- Greeting message — the first message visitors see when the chat opens
- Personality — friendly, professional, or casual depending on your audience
Spend a few minutes on this. A well-branded chatbot builds trust. A generic-looking one can hurt your credibility.
Step 4: Install on Your Website
This is where it gets platform-specific. The good news: every method involves pasting a single script tag. Here's how to do it on the five most popular platforms.
WordPress
Option A: Theme Editor (2 minutes)
- Log in to your WordPress admin dashboard
- Go to Appearance → Theme File Editor
- Select your footer.php file from the right sidebar
- Paste your chatbot script tag just before the
</body>tag - Click Update File
Option B: Plugin (1 minute)
- Install the "Insert Headers and Footers" plugin (by WPBeginner)
- Go to Settings → Insert Headers and Footers
- Paste your script in the "Scripts in Footer" box
- Save
The plugin method is safer because it survives theme updates. We recommend it for most WordPress users.
Shopify
- From your Shopify admin, go to Online Store → Themes
- Click the three dots menu on your current theme and select Edit Code
- In the Layout folder, open theme.liquid
- Scroll to the bottom and paste your script tag just before
</body> - Click Save
That's it. The chatbot will appear on every page of your Shopify store.
Wix
- In your Wix dashboard, go to Settings → Custom Code
- Click + Add Code
- Paste your script tag in the code box
- Set Name to "ChatLeadAI" (or any label)
- Set Place Code in to "Body - End"
- Set Add Code to Pages to "All Pages"
- Click Apply
Squarespace
- Go to your Squarespace site and open Settings
- Navigate to Advanced → Code Injection
- Paste your script tag in the Footer field
- Click Save
Note: Code Injection is only available on Squarespace Business plans and above.
Custom HTML / Static Site
If you have a custom-built website or a static HTML site, this is the simplest installation of all:
- Open your main HTML file (usually
index.html) - Paste the script tag just before the closing
</body>tag - Upload the file to your server
If you're using a framework like React, Next.js, or Astro, you can add the script tag to your root layout component or use the framework's script injection method.
Step 5: Test and Refine
Don't just install and forget. Spend 5 minutes testing your chatbot:
- Ask it questions your real customers ask — Does it give accurate answers?
- Test the lead capture flow — Does it collect contact info naturally?
- Check it on mobile — Most chatbot widgets are responsive, but verify
- Try to break it — Ask off-topic questions and see how it handles them
If the bot gives incorrect answers, you may need to add more content to its training data. Most platforms let you update the training content at any time without reinstalling the widget.
Common Mistakes to Avoid
After helping hundreds of businesses set up chatbots, here are the most common mistakes we see:
- Not training the bot properly. If you only feed it your homepage content, it won't know about your pricing, services, or FAQs. Give it everything.
- Using a generic greeting. "How can I help you?" is fine, but a specific greeting converts better. Try: "Hi! Are you looking for [your main service]? I can help with pricing, scheduling, or any questions."
- Forgetting mobile users. Over 60% of web traffic is mobile. Make sure the chat widget doesn't block important content on small screens.
- Never checking the conversations. Review your chatbot's conversations weekly. You'll learn what customers are actually asking, and you can improve your training data accordingly.
- Treating it as "set and forget." The best results come from iterating. Update your training content when your business changes, tweak the greeting based on what works, and keep refining.
The businesses that get the most leads from chatbots are the ones that treat them like a team member — they onboard them properly, check in regularly, and keep their knowledge up to date.
What to Expect After Installation
Once your chatbot is live, here's a realistic timeline of what happens:
- Day 1-3: You'll start seeing conversations trickle in. Don't panic if the volume is low — visitors need to discover and trust the widget.
- Week 1: You should see your first leads come through. Review the conversations to see how the bot is performing.
- Week 2-4: As you refine the bot's training data and greeting, conversation quality and lead capture rates improve.
- Month 2+: At this point, your chatbot is a reliable lead generation channel. Most businesses see a 15-30% increase in lead capture compared to contact forms alone.
Ready to Add a Chatbot to Your Website?
You've read the guide. You know it takes less than 5 minutes. The only question is: how many leads are you losing while your website visitors have unanswered questions?
ChatLeadAI offers a genuinely free plan — no credit card, no 14-day trial that auto-charges. Create your chatbot, train it on your website, and paste one line of code. That's the whole process.
Add an AI chatbot to your website in 2 minutes
Free plan. No credit card. Works on WordPress, Shopify, Wix, Squarespace, and any HTML site.
Set Up Your Chatbot Free